Old Ryazan Hillfort to Become the Site of a Large-Scale Festival

The press service of the regional ministry of culture has announced that on July 20, the festival "Old Ryazan - a place of traditions, a place of glory, a place of power" will be held on the Old Ryazan hillfort. The program includes performances by folk groups, a fair of folk crafts, an exhibition of works of the art competition, round dances and games.

"The tasks of the event are to preserve and popularize cultural heritage sites, create conditions for the development of inbound and event tourism, form a brand of the place, attract the artistic community and the general public, and create a new center of attraction in Russia," the message says.

Old Ryazan is located in the Spassky District of the Ryazan Region on the banks of the Oka River and is one of the oldest and largest hillforts in Russia. In the XII-XIII centuries, the city was the capital of the Great Ryazan Principality,as well as its economic and cultural center.

Now the hillfort will open a window into the past, and a bright cultural atmosphere will be created on its territory for the guests of the holiday. The event will be attended by singer Pyotr Nalich, Honored Artist of Russia Alexei Zardinov, the State Street Theater of Cardboard and several other theaters from different regions of the country.
